Effects Of Two New Potassium Fertilizers On Potassium Transport In Soil-Flue-cured Tobacco In Southern Main Tobacco-growing Areas

Potassium is the important nutrient and quality element of tobacco,potassium content is one of the important index of tobacco quality evaluation.Applying potassium fertilizer can promote the growth metabolism of flue-cured tobacco,affect the quality and the smoking quality of tobacco,improve the luster,combustibility and capability of keep fire of tobacco leaf and hold fire and conducive to the accumulation of sugar and formation of tobacco aroma of tobacco leaf.The tobacco leaf potassium content is below 2%in our country,potassium levels cann,t meet the high quality tobacco leaves in most of the tobacco growing area.Low potassium content of tobacco is one of the important factors that limit the leaf quality of high quality tobacco in our country.The main factors which create the low potassium content of tobacco leaf in our country are:the rapid available potassium fertilizer used such as potassium sulphate and potassium nitrate are easy leached in soil;the soil potassium fixation is severe,the potassium applied into the soil meet the soil potassium fixation first then supply the growth of flue-cured tobacco;the intensity of potassium providing of soil cann,t match the law of potassium requirement of tobacco growth;the accumulation and distribution of potassium in tobacco are unreasonable,most of the potassium accumulate and distribute in root,stem and lower tobacco leaves after the maturity of tobacco.This paper took K326 as material,studied the rule and influence factor of potassium release,potassium fixation and potassium leaching of citrate soluble potassium fertilizer and humate potassium fertilizer,researched the influence of combined application of new potassium fertilizers and potassium sulfate on growth and accumulation and distribution of potassium of tobacco using pot experiment,verified the influence of combined application of new potassium fertilizer and potassium sulfate on growth and accumulation and distribution of potassium of tobacco in different soil types in the tobacco growing area of fen-flavor and luzhou-flavor by field experiment.This research selected the citrate soluble potassium fertilizer and humate potassium fertilizer which had better potassium release effect then applied to yellow soil and paddy soil in main tobacco areas in south to increase the content of potassium of tobacco and utilization rate of potassium.The specific research results of this paper were as follows:?1?Studied some physical and chemical properties of citrate soluble potassium fertilizer and humate potassium fertilizer,then researched the potassium leaching property in soil of new potassium fertilizers.The results showed that,the Ph of citrate soluble potassium fertilizer and humate potassium fertilizer were 11.16 and 10.15 respectively presented strong alkali which was beneficial to the improvement of acid soil;the solubility of new potassium fertilizer was lower in water?the citrate soluble potassium fertilizer was slightly soluble?,the solubility in citric acid liquor were 6.45 g/L and 14.96 g/L respectively which had guaranteed the potassium liberation in acid soil.The potassium leaching property showed potassium sulfate>citrate soluble potassium fertilizer>humate potassium fertilizer.Accumulated amount of leaching of K+and apparent leaching rate of citrate soluble potassium fertilizer were lower in yellow soil,they were also lower for humate potassium fertilizer in paddy soil.New potassium fertilizers could reduce the leaching amount of calcium in soil and were helpful to prevent the soil harden.The determinants of accumulated amount of leaching of K+of potassium fertilizer were total potassium content and slowly available potassium content of soil.The determinant of apparent leaching rate of potassium fertilizer was slowly available potassium content of soil.The higher slowly available potassium content,the higher risk of potash fertilizer leaching.?2?Researched the influence of low molecular organic acids and cationics on potassium liberation of new potassium fertilizers.The results showed that,the low molecular organic acids such as oxalic acid,tartaric acid and citric acid and cationics such as Ca2+,NH4+and Na+could improve the potassium liberation of citrate soluble potassium fertilizer and humate potassium fertilizer.The effect of extracting agents on potassium liberation of citrate soluble potassium fertilizer showed oxalic acid>citric acid>tartaric acid>Ca2+>NH4+>Na+,Theeffectshowedoxalicacid>citricacid>tartaric acid>NH4+>Ca2+>Na+for humate potassium fertilizer.With the concentration improvement of low molecular organic acids and cation,the potassium liberation amount of citrate soluble potassium fertilizer and humate potassium fertilizer significant increased,and the citrate soluble potassium fertilizer had higher potassium liberation amount.?3?Studied the potassium fixation of new potassium fertilizers in different soil types.The results showed that,yellow soil and paddy soil had potassium fixation effect on potassium sulfate and new potassium fertilizers,the power of potassium fixation of soil showed potassium sulfate>citrate soluble potassium fertilizer>humate potassium fertilizer and the yellow soli was lower than paddy soil.The potassium fixation showed positive correlation with time and alternation of drying and wetting.The yellow soil had higher fixation ability than paddy soil with alternation of drying and wetting.Soil temperature could reduce the soil potassium fixation,but the effect was lower than moisture.?4?Researched the influence of combined application of new potassium fertilizers and potassium sulfate on growth and accumulation and distribution of potassium of tobacco using pot experiment.The results showed that,the combined application of new potassium fertilizers and potassium sulfate could promote the growth of flue-cured tobacco and increase dry matter accumulation of tobacco plant,the combined application of slow efficiency fertilizer and potassium sulfate had better effect than single application of them under the same amount of potassium nutrient inputs.The combined application of citrate soluble potassium fertilizer and potassium sulfate had better effect in yellow soil,the combined application of humate potassium fertilizer and potassium sulfate had better effect in paddy soil and the ratio of combined application was 25%potassium sulfate.This combined application could improve the potassium content of tobacco leaves of different parts and the best ratio of combined application for citrate soluble potassium fertilizer and humate potassium fertilizer was 50%-75%.The combined application of new potassium fertilizers and potassium sulfate could increase potassium content of economic area,facilitate potassium transfer from root,stem to leaf,promote the potassium accumulation.?5?Studied the influence of combined application of new potassium fertilizers and potassium sulfate on growth and leaf quality of tobacco by field experiment.The results showed that,the combined application of new potassium fertilizers and potassium sulfate could promote the growth of flue-cured tobacco and increase dry matter accumulation,facilitate the potassium distribution in plant and potassium accumulation in leaves,coordinate the chemical composition proportion of cured tobacco leaves,promote the improvement of quality of upper leaves,the increase of average price and the production value of tobacco leaves.25%citrate soluble potassium fertilizer with 75%potassium sulfate had the best effect in yellow soil,25%humate potassium fertilizer with 75%potassium sulfate had the best effect in paddy soil,the growth of tobacco in Hunan tobacco area was better than in Yunnan.For the effect on dry matter accumulation of root,the combined application of 50%citrate soluble potassium fertilizer and 50%potassium sulfate was the best in yellow soil and 50%humate potassium with 50%potassium sulfate was the best in paddy soil.The combined application of new potassium fertilizers and potassium sulfate could promote the distribution of potassium in leaves and stem,for the effect on potassium accumulation,the combined application of 50%citrate soluble potassium fertilizer and 50%potassium sulfate was the best in yellow soil and 50%humate potassium fertilizer with 50%potassium sulfate was the best in paddy soil in different tobacco growing area.Generally speaking,tobacco in Hunan tobacco area had higher potassium accumulation content and more coherent chemical composition in the same soil type.
